Os estudantes de Medicina têm contato com diferentes áreas e cenários durante o internato e devem ter seu desempenho avaliado em cada um deles. Contudo, muitos estudantes não se sentem devidamente avaliados e, diante disso, nosso objetivo foi desenvolver um instrumento de avaliação do desempenho de estudantes de Medicina, no período do internato em pediatria, para uso durante o estágio realizado na Atenção Primária à Saúde. Realizou-se uma pesquisa metodológica com elaboração de um instrumento e contribuição de especialistas com experiência em ensino, por meio de convites eletrônicos. Ao final do estudo, utilizando-se a técnica Delphi, dos vinte itens constantes no instrumento original, dezessete foram aceitos pelos 11 especialistas que participaram das duas rodadas de análise. Dessa forma, a pesquisa alcançou seu objetivo e, por meio deste artigo, divulgamos a proposta de um "Instrumento de avaliação de internos de Medicina no estágio de pediatria na Atenção Primária à Saúde".


Medical students have contact with different areas and scenarios during their internship and must have their performance evaluated in each of them. However, as many students do not feel properly evaluated, our objective was to develop an instrument to evaluate the performance of Medical students, during their internship in pediatrics, to be used during their practice in Primary Health Care. A methodological research was carried out with the elaboration of an instrument and the contribution of specialists with experience in teaching, using electronic invitations. At the end of the study, through the Delphi technique, seventeen of the twenty items contained in the original instrument were accepted by the 11 specialists who participated in the two rounds of analysis. Thus, the research reached its objective and, through this article, we disseminate the proposal of an "Instrument for the evaluation of Medical interns in the pediatric internship in Primary Health Care".

The aim of the present study was to evaluate the use of supercritical CO2 combined with cosolvent for the recovery of bioactive compounds of soybean fermented with Rhizopus oligosporus NRRL 2710. Soxhlet extractions using seven different organic solvents (n-hexane, petroleum ether, ethyl acetate, acetone, ethanol, methanol, and water) were initially performed for comparative purposes. The extracts obtained were characterized by physicochemical, antioxidant, total phenolic, and oxidative proprieties. For the Soxhlet extractions, the highest and lowest yields obtained were 45.24% and 15.56%, using methanol and hexane, respectively. The extraction using supercritical CO2 combined with ethanol as a static modifier (scCO2 + EtOH) presented, at a high pressure (25 MPa) and temperature (80 °C), a phenolic compound content of 1391.9 µg GAE g-1 and scavenging of 0.17 g, reaching a 42.87% yield. The extracts obtained by sCO2 + EtOH were characterized by high contents of essential fatty acids (linoleic acid and oleic acid) and bioactive compounds (gallic acid, trans-cinnamic acid, daidzein, and genistein). These extracts also showed a great potential for inhibiting hyaluronidase enzymes (i.e., anti-inflammatory activity). Thermogravimetric analyses of the samples showed similar profiles, with oil degradation values in the range from 145 to 540 °C, indicating progressive oil decomposition with a mass loss ranging from 93 to 98.7%. In summary, this study demonstrated the flexibility of scCO2 + EtOH as a green technology that can be used to obtain high-value-added products from fermented soybean.

A atuação do farmacêutico em análises clínicas está diretamente relacionada com o estudo e o diagnóstico da saúde do paciente. O presente artigo objetivou compreender a percepção de farmacêuticos analistas clínicos em relação à sua formação acadêmica. A pesquisa contou com a participação de farmacêuticos que atuam como analistas clínicos em um laboratório. Os dados coletados foram analisados pela técnica de análise de conteúdo e divididos em duas categorias: formação acadêmica e formação em análises clínicas. O resultado mostra que as aulas práticas durante a graduação são de suma importância, pois propiciam que o futuro farmacêutico analista clínico desenvolva habilidades e atitudes atreladas ao conhecimento. Constatou-se também que os conhecimentos teóricos propiciam o embasamento para a prática e que a formação do farmacêutico analista clínico deve priorizar o contexto em que estará inserido de forma proativa na equipes multiprofissionais e na sociedade.


The work of the medical laboratory scientist is directly related to the study and diagnosis of the patient's health. This study aimed to understand the opinion of medical laboratory scientists regarding their academic training. The research had the participation of pharmacists who work as medical laboratory scientists. The collected data were analyzed using the content analysis technique and divided into two categories: academic training and clinical analysis training. The result shows that practical classes during the undergraduate course are of paramount importance, as they allow the future medical laboratory scientist to develop skills and attitudes linked to knowledge. It was also found that theoretical knowledge provides the basis for the practice and that the training of the medical laboratory scientist shall prioritize the context where he/she will be proactively inserted in the multiprofessional teams and in society.

Liquidambar styraciflua L., ALTINGIACEAE, popularly known as sweet gum or alligator tree, is an aromatic tree with a natural distribution in North America and acclimated in Brazil. In traditional medicine, L. styraciflua L is used for the treatment of stomach disorders, wounds, and coughs. The present study was designed to investigate the biological potential and chemical profile of extracts obtained from aerial parts of L. styraciflua L. The chemical profile was established using liquid chromatography-mass spectrometry analysis and the extracts were tested for total phenolics, flavonoids, and tannins using spectrophotometric assays. The anti-inflammatory activity of L. styraciflua L was tested using an inhibition of hyaluronidase enzyme assay, and cytotoxic activities were tested by the 3-(4,5-dimethylthiazol-2 yl)-2, 5-diphenyl tetrazolium bromide (MTT) assay. The synergy between the plant extracts with ciprofloxacin and tetracycline was studied by the checkerboard assay method against eight bacterial strains.The phytochemical investigation showed that the leaves and stem are rich in phenolics compounds (1419.34-1614.02 mg GAE/g, 875.21-1557.57 mg GAE/g, respectively), mainly flavonoids and hydrolyzable tannins. The samples of the stem exhibited the best anti-inflammatory activity. The butanol fraction of the stem was better than the commercial propolis extract. The hydroalcoholic extract of the stem and the propolis did not exhibit significant differences (p < 0.05) at any of the concentrations tested. A synergistic interaction was observed against the Gram-positive bacterial Enterococcus faecalis (hydroalcoholic extract of leaves and tetracycline) and Staphylococcus aureus (hydroalcoholic extract of stem and tetracycline). The IC50 values obtained for the extracts indicate the absence of toxicity and moderate cytotoxic for the hydroalcoholic extract of the stem. On the basis of our findings, L. styaciflua may be considered as a potential therapeutic source with high anti-inflammatory activity and synergistic interactions with antibiotics against bacteria.

The search for new bioactive molecules is a driving force for research pharmaceutical industries, especially those molecules obtained from fermentation. The molecules possessing angiogenic and anti-inflammatory attributes have attracted attention and are the focus of this study. Angiogenic activity from kefir polysaccharide extract, via chorioallantoic membrane assay, exhibited a pro-angiogenic effect compared with vascular endothelial factor (pro-angiogenic) and hydrocortisone (anti-angiogenic) activity as standards with an EC50 of 192ng/mL. In terms of anti-inflammatory activity determined via hyaluronidase enzyme assay, kefir polysaccharide extract inhibited the enzyme with a minimal activity of 2.08mg/mL and a maximum activity of 2.57mg/mL. For pharmaceutical purposes, kefir polysaccharide extract is considered to be safe because it does not inhibit VERO cells in cytotoxicity assays.
